The streets of Manchester will be sparkling this weekend when the First Day of Christmas event comes to town. The celebration takes place this Saturday - the day after the city’s popular Christmas Markets open - and will see 'a magical line-up of family-friendly entertainment across the city centre'.
It promises to transport visitors 'to a winter wonderland like no other', filled with festive characters, illuminations, live music, plus lots more.
Organised by Manchester Business Improvement District, the city-wide event - from noon until 7pm on Saturday, November 13 - will see more than 50 performers appear on the city’s streets throughout the day as they help Manchester celebrate the first day of Christmas, 'bringing festive joy to all'.
